本文整理汇总了PHP中Ticket::getTicket方法的典型用法代码示例。如果您正苦于以下问题:PHP Ticket::getTicket方法的具体用法?PHP Ticket::getTicket怎么用?PHP Ticket::getTicket使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Ticket
的用法示例。
在下文中一共展示了Ticket::getTicket方法的5个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: testUniqueness
public function testUniqueness()
{
// Tests for uniqueness
$ticket = new Ticket(null, $this->db);
$text = explode("\n", shell_exec("python bingo.py"))[0];
$ticket->fromString($text);
$numbers = [];
foreach ($ticket->getTicket() as $row) {
foreach ($row as $number) {
if ($number != "") {
$numbers[] = $number;
}
}
}
$isUnique = count($numbers) === count(array_unique($numbers, SORT_NUMERIC));
$this->assertTrue($isUnique);
}
示例2: User
<?php
include 'admin_header.php';
$user = new User();
$view = new View();
$ticket = new Ticket();
$support_id = $ticket->getSupportId();
$uid = intval($_GET['uid']);
$ticket_id = intval($_GET['ticket_id']);
$selected_ticket = $ticket->getTicket($ticket_id);
$tickets = $ticket->getTickets($uid);
?>
<!-- content wrapper -->
<div class="container-full">
<!-- page row -->
<div class="row">
<!-- sidebar -->
<div class="col-sm-2 sidebar-wrapper">
<ul class="sidebar-nav">
<li class="sidebar-brand">
<a href="#">
Admin
</a>
</li>
<!-- shows the categories as list elements -->
<?php
$view->showAdminMenu();
?>
示例3: archivaTicket
public static function archivaTicket($id)
{
$db = Tool::_conectaBD();
$archivado = false;
if (!$db) {
//error
//echo "Error conectando <br/>";
} else {
if (!Ticket::estaArchivado($id)) {
$aux = new Ticket();
$aux->getTicket($id);
$sql = "INSERT INTO HistoricoTickets (IdCompra,Codigo,IdTipo,Entregado) VALUES " . "('" . $aux->IdCompra . "','" . $aux->codigo . "','" . $aux->IdTipo . "',0)";
if ($aux->codigo != "") {
if (Tool::ejecutaConsulta($sql, $db)) {
$archivado = true;
} else {
//error
echo "Error insertando " . $aux->codigo . "<br/>SQL: " . $sql . "</br>";
}
} else {
//error
echo "Error obteniendo " . $id . "<br/>SQL: " . $sql . "</br>";
}
} else {
$archivado = true;
}
if ($archivado) {
Ticket::deleteTicket($id);
}
}
Tool::_desconectaBD($db);
return $archivado;
}
示例4: session_start
session_start();
include "../../bossflex/Helpers/Reject.php";
Reject::permission($_SESSION['bfUser']);
include "../../bossflex/DB/Models/BossFlexEmployee.php";
include "../../bossflex/DB/Models/Employee.php";
include "../../bossflex/DB/Models/User.php";
include "../../bossflex/DB/Models/Company.php";
include "../../bossflex/DB/Models/Ticket.php";
include "../../bossflex/Helpers/Material.php";
include "../../bossflex/Helpers/BFPage.php";
$bfEmp = BossFlexEmployee::getEmployeeByBFID($_SESSION['bfUser']['EID']);
$user = User::getUserByUID($_SESSION['bfUser']['UID']);
$error = false;
$success = false;
if (isset($_GET['t'])) {
$ticket = Ticket::getTicket($_GET['t']);
Ticket::assignTicket($bfEmp, $ticket);
$success = "Ticket " . $ticket->getTicketNum() . " Assigned to You";
}
$tickets = Ticket::unassignedTickets();
?>
<html>
<header>
<?php
Material::headers("Unassigned Tickets");
?>
<link rel="stylesheet" type="text/css" href="https://cdn.datatables.net/1.10.10/css/jquery.dataTables.min.css">
<script type="text/javascript" language="javascript" src="https://cdn.datatables.net/1.10.10/js/jquery.dataTables.min.js">
</script>
示例5: header
if (isset($ticketNum) && !(isset($accept) || isset($decline))) {
$ticket = Ticket::getTicket($ticketNum);
} else {
if (isset($decline) && isset($ticketNum)) {
$ticket = Ticket::getTicket($ticketNum);
if (!isset($comment) || !($comment > "")) {
$error = "Closing Comment Must Be Set If Declining";
} else {
$ticket->setClosingComment($comment);
Ticket::closeTicket($ticket, false);
//decline ticket
$getNextTicket = true;
}
} else {
if (isset($accept) && isset($ticketNum)) {
$ticket = Ticket::getTicket($ticketNum);
Ticket::closeTicket($ticket, true);
//accept ticket
$getNextTicket = true;
}
}
}
}
if ($getNextTicket) {
$tickets = Ticket::assignedTicketList($bfEmp);
if (!$tickets) {
header("Location: Home.php?s=" . urlencode("All tickets reviewed!"));
exit;
}
$ticket = reset($tickets);
$ticketNum = $ticket->getTicketNum();